Griffon Women's 11-game win streak ends at No. 13/19 UNK

KEARNEY, Neb. — Missouri Western Women's Basketball lost to No. 13/19 Nebraska Kearney on Saturday afternoon, 91-55, at the Health & Sports Center.

Connie Clarke led the Griffons (18-5, 12-3 MIAA) with 13 points and four rebounds, while Trinity Knapp and Johnni Gonzalez both added 11 points. 

Four players scored in double digits for the Lopers (20-3, 13-2 MIAA), led by Shiloh McCool's 16 points. 
 
The first half was marked by a slow first quarter, as the Griffons finished the quarter down, 28-8. The second quarter saw the Griffs fire back, cutting into the lead and winning the quarter, 19-14. The game went to halftime, 42-27.

The second half was more of the same, as UNK once again jumped on the Griffons out of the interval. The Griffons were outscored in the quarter, 22-8, and went into the fourth quarter down, 64-35. Missouri Western showed signs of life, battling hard in the fourth quarter, but Kearney was able to extend the lead, eventually winning, 91-55.

NOTABLES
  • The Griffons split the regular-season series with the Lopers with the loss.
  • Missouri Western struggled to get it going from deep, only shooting 3-of-17 from three.
  • Thirteen Griffons played in the game, and 10 scored.
